2核2G内存的服务器在大多数情况下是可以稳定运行一个中小型WordPress企业网站的,但是否“稳定”取决于多个因素。下面我们来详细分析:
✅ 一、适合的场景(可以稳定运行)
如果你的企业站满足以下条件,2核2G配置是足够的:
- 日均访问量较低:每天几百到几千PV(页面浏览量),并发用户数不超过50人。
- 内容以静态为主:如公司介绍、产品展示、新闻动态等,没有复杂的交互功能。
- 使用了缓存机制:
- 安装了缓存插件(如 WP Super Cache、W3 Total Cache、LiteSpeed Cache)。
- 配置了OPcache、Redis或Memcached(可选,提升性能)。
- 优化良好的主题和插件:
- 使用轻量级、代码规范的主题(避免使用臃肿的多用途主题)。
- 插件数量控制在10个以内,避免加载过多脚本和数据库查询。
- 使用LNMP或LAMP优化环境:
- Nginx + PHP-FPM 比 Apache 更节省资源。
- MySQL/MariaDB 配置合理,避免占用过高内存。
⚠️ 二、可能不稳定的情况
如果出现以下情况,2核2G可能会出现卡顿甚至宕机:
- 高并发访问:突然流量激增(如被推荐、SEO爆发),超过服务器处理能力。
- 未启用缓存:每次访问都动态生成页面,PHP和MySQL负载高。
- 使用大量插件或重型主题:比如Elementor+大量模块、WooCommerce电商功能等。
- 遭受攻击或爬虫泛滥:如DDoS、恶意扫描、垃圾评论机器人等。
- 数据库未优化:数据表未索引、定期清理,导致查询缓慢。
🛠 三、优化建议(让2核2G更稳定)
- 使用缓存:
- 页面缓存(静态HTML)
- 浏览器缓存
- OPcache(PHP字节码缓存)
- 选择轻量级环境:
- 推荐:Nginx + PHP 8.x + MariaDB + Let’s Encrypt SSL
- 可用宝塔面板(Linux版)或AMH等简化管理
- 限制资源消耗:
- 设置PHP内存限制(如256M)
- 限制上传大小和执行时间
- 定期维护:
- 清理垃圾评论、修订版本、过期数据
- 数据库优化(OPTIMIZE TABLE)
- 监控资源使用:
- 使用
htop、glances或宝塔监控,观察CPU、内存、磁盘IO使用情况
- 使用
📊 参考性能数据(估算)
| 项目 | 2核2G表现 |
|---|---|
| 同时在线用户 | 30-80人(有缓存) |
| 页面加载速度 | <1.5秒(优化后) |
| 内存使用 | 正常负载下 1.2~1.6G |
| 抗压能力 | 能应对一般流量,突发需缓存支撑 |
✅ 结论
可以稳定运行,但前提是:
- 网站内容简单、结构清晰
- 合理配置服务器环境
- 启用缓存并定期维护
对于绝大多数中小型企业官网(非电商、无会员系统、无高并发需求),2核2G服务器完全够用,性价比很高。
🔁 升级建议
如果未来计划:
- 增加电商功能(WooCommerce)
- 支持会员系统或API接口
- 日均访问量上万
- 视频/大图较多
建议升级到 2核4G 或 4核4G,并搭配CDN和对象存储(如阿里云OSS、腾讯云COS)进一步提升稳定性。
如有具体流量数据或功能需求,可以提供更多信息,我可以帮你评估更精准的配置建议。
CLOUD技术笔记